VITAS’ trains and certifies friendly, well-behaved pets to be Paw Pals®. A registered VITAS Paw Pals visitor, with its human, knows how to visit patients near the end of life.

VITAS Paw Pals:
- Offer comfort
- Bring back memories
- Encourage activity
- Provide unconditional love
“VITAS Paw Pals can sometimes reach a patient when no one else can,” says Annice Kennedy-Hanlon, manager of volunteer services. “Our Paw Pals brighten the day for everyone when they visit. I think even the animals know what an important function they fulfill.”
